  6. I have noticed that for a Tank, it shows the base Accuracy of Energy Melee being .75 on all lower tier attacks. However, the in game information shows that these same attacks are 1.00x. It also shows that Whirling Hands only has a 8 meter radius, however, (I can't check at the moment) I am fairly certain Whirling Hands is one of the many power that Tanks got a buff to radius on...which if this is true, is another case where Mids Reborn is wrong. Is it missing an update since the patch or is this using old information from live?

  19. Why was Fearsome Stare changed for Fade? IMO the set feels a lot weaker since the change. Fearsome Stare had a nice pseudo hold along with a really nice accuracy debuff, which IMO was a lot more useful on a Controller than Fade. I honestly can't get into the Darkness Secondary for Controllers anymore because of the change, it's just not the same and nowhere near as useful for me. Was the change really necessary? What was the actual reason for the change?
